This document specifies a method for the enumeration of Escherichia coli (E. coli) in organic fertilizers, organo-mineral fertilizers, inorganic fertilizers which contain more than 1 % by mass of organic carbon, other than organic carbon from chelating or complexing agents, nitrification inhibitors, denitrification inhibitors or urease inhibitors, coating agents, urea or calcium cyanamide [1]. The method is tested for solid and liquid products.
This document is applicable to the fertilizing products blends where a blend is a mix of at least two of the following components: Fertilizers, Liming Materials, Soil Improvers, Growing Media, Inhibitors, Plant Biostimulants, and where the following category: organic fertilizers, organo-mineral fertilizers, inorganic fertilizer is the highest % in the blend by mass or volume, or in the case of liquid form by dry mass. If the organic fertilizer, the organo-mineral fertilizer or the inorganic fertilizer is not the highest % in the blend, the European Standard for the highest % of the blend applies. In case a fertilizing product blend is composed of components in equal quantity, the user decides which standard to apply.
Strains of E. coli which do not grow at 44 °C and, in particular, those that are β-D-glucuronidase negative, such as E. coli O157, will not be detected. Some genera within the family Enterobacteriaceae, in particular Shigella spp. and Salmonella spp., can also show β-D-glucuronidase activity at 44 °C.
NOTE: This method has been validated in an interlaboratory study with specific products that were present on the market during the study.
